Понимание механизмов развития и течения остеомиелита заставляет специалистовпо-новому взглянуть на причины неудач в борьбе со столь тяжелой патологией и изменить подходы к профилактике, диагностике и лечению.</p></abstract><trans-abstract xml:lang="en"><p>Abstract Over the past decades, there has been a steady increase in the incidence of osteomyelitis. It is associated with an increased use of implants intraumatology and orthopedics. The social aspects of osteomyelitis are, on the one hand, significant financial costs for the healthcare system, and on theother hand, high recurrence and re-infection in the treatment of joint pathology associated with long-term loss of work ability and a high risk of patient’sdisability. Purpose To conduct a search and analysis of publications in Russian and English, devoted to the problem of osteomyelitis and periprostheticinfection, on the basis of which to summarize the main current notions about the etiology, pathogenesis, diagnosis and treatment of osteomyelitis.Materials and methods The search was carried out in the Pubmed and CyberLeninka databases of literature sources over the past 10 years. The datawere analyzed and compared with the materials from earlier publications. Only publications from peer-reviewed journals were considered for analysis.Results and discussion Success in the treatment of peri-implant infection with prosthesis re-implantation and satisfactory joint function has beenachieved in only just more than a half of patients. Recent studies have significantly changed the understanding of the etiology and pathogenesis ofosteomyelitis. It has been proven that in osteomyelitis and implant-associated infection, four reservoirs of infection are formed in the patient's body:abscesses in soft tissues and bone marrow canal, biofilms on the surface of implants and necrotic tissues, intracellular colonization with bacteria of themacroorganism and lacunar-canalicular system. Understanding the mechanisms of osteomyelitis development and its course forces the specialists totake a fresh look at the causes of failures in the fight against such a severe pathology and change approaches to its prevention, diagnosis and treatment.</p></trans-abstract></article-meta></front><back><ref-list><title>References</title></ref-list><fn-group><fn fn-type="conflict"><p>The authors declare that there are no conflicts of interest present.</p></fn></fn-group></back></article>
